The campsite offers an overall great experience with beautiful hiking trails and scenic views, particularly with remnants of a historical POW camp adding interest. Many reviewers praised the quiet and natural setting, making it ideal for camping and hiking, despite some concerns about cleanliness and safety due to trash left behind by visitors and wildlife warnings. While some areas of the trail were noted to be overgrown and challenging, the beauty of the location and unique features like the cool remnants of military history received high marks. However, this site has some issues with improper waste disposal by previous visitors that detracted slightly from the experience.
